Hospitality work and breaks - new to country and need help. by ClearSuggestion5465 in LegalAdviceUK

[–]WaddoUK 21 points22 points  (0 children)

Speak to Chef or the owner. They are responsible for your welfare and ensuring you take your breaks. They are also responsible for ensuring your station is covered during your break. Kitchens are very busy, but that is for Chef to manage. (Experience: Years worked in hospitality)

Uber by hannahroseviolin in LakeDistrict

[–]WaddoUK 5 points6 points  (0 children)

A few private hire vehicles are operating in the Lakes, with Uber signage. Don't forget Uber is just a booking system, they don't own or manage any of the drivers or vehicles. The drivers have to pay Uber around 20% of the fare as a fee. You'll notice the vehicles and drivers are not locally licensed operators, and they are essentially taking business away from local operators.
